July 14, 2009
I took a bit of a Sabbath today. After what may be our last Committee meeting this morning, a few hours on the floor of the House of Deputies, and Eucharist, I traded out with Pat Russell, our Clergy Alternate, and took the afternoon and evening off. I spent some time visiting the House of Bishops, in the Exhibit Hall, and thinking about considering packing up Thin I went to Disneyland. Since it's right here, about a 15 minute walk, it seemed obligatory. There were more people there than in most of the counties I have lived in; but it was a pleasant time, and it was fun to see the nightly fireworks right in front of me, although the view from the Hospitality Suite is more comfortable.
I hear that the Deputies were busy while I was gone, passing the Bishop's version of D-025. During the morning session, we spent a lot of time on the revision to Lesser Feasts and Fasts, and ended up agreeing with the Standing Liturgical Commission and the Committee on Liturgy and Worship and adding over 100 names, for trial use, to the Church's calendar. I think it's silly, but you can't win 'em all.
As always, there is no telling what tomorrow will bring.
